Rates & Terms
Rates in OK are influenced by the prime rate, your credit score, combined LTV, and whether the property is your primary residence.
Home equity loan rates in Broken Arrow for 2026 typically range from 7% to 10% for borrowers with good credit and loan-to-value ratios below 80%.
Requirements in Broken Arrow
Lenders in Broken Arrow verify income, employment, and assets; self-employed borrowers may need additional documentation.
Most Broken Arrow lenders require at least 15-20% equity in your home, meaning your mortgage balance must be 80-85% or less of the appraised value.

Local Market Insights
Local credit unions in Broken Arrow, OK often offer the lowest home equity rates and most flexible terms.
Property tax assessments in OK may differ from market value; get a professional appraisal for accurate equity calculations.
Borrowing Tips for Broken Arrow
- Calculate your combined loan-to-value ratio before applying; keep it below 80% for the best rates.
- Understand the risk: defaulting on a home equity loan can lead to foreclosure on your primary residence.
- Use home equity for value-adding purposes; avoid borrowing against your home for depreciating assets or discretionary spending.
